Apple and Prune Tart
Preparation time: 20 minutes
Cooking time: 40 minutes
Ingredients
- 125g unsalted butter, diced
- 1/2 cup caster sugar
- 1 1/2 cups plain flour
- 1 egg
Filling
- 2 eggs
- 1/2 cup milk
- 2/3 cup caster s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la essence
- 1 cup Angas Park Pitted Prunes, quartered
- 1 cup Angas Park Dried Apples, halved
Method
- Place butter and sugar in a food processor and process until smooth. Add flour and egg and process until mixture forms a ball. Press into a well-greased 18cm loose-bottomed flan tin. Blind bake in a pre-heated moderate oven (170ºC-190ºC) for 10 minutes.
- Filling: Place eggs, milk, 1/3 cup of the sugar and vanilla in a bowl and whisk to combine. Spread fruit over the pastry and pour over the custard mixture. Sprinkle with remaining sugar.
- Return to oven for 35-40 minutes or until custard has set. Cool before slicing. Serve with cream.
Serves 6
